Dr. Rodolfo Arcovedo attended the Mexican School of Medicine of La Salle University from 1985 through 1991. In 1992, he pursued his specialization in the United States. He completed his internship and residency at Chestnut Hill Hospital. In 1993 he joined the University of Illinois Metropolitan Group Program in General Surgery in Chicago. He soon assumed a leadership role and graduated from the program in 1999. Dr. Arcovedo is certified by the American Board of General Surgery
